St. Joseph addresses brush pickup

The Village of St. Joseph is suspending brush pick up for a second month in a row.

The wet Spring weather has prevented the village from burning the brush that has already been picked up and the village burn site is full.


To alleviate some of the backlogged brush, the Village of St. Joseph has entered into a contract with Mashburn Rental for 30 days. The contract is not to exceed $6,700.


The machine the village is renting will burn a portion of the backlogged yard waste at the dump site located along Rt. 150.

The village will discuss purchasing the equipment after they see how effective it is.

The purchase price of the equipment is $34, 350 and the rental price would be applied towards the purchase cost.

Additionally, the Environmental Protection Agency has contacted the village regarding the burning on the site. There are many requirements that the village must comply with to continue burning. The Buildings and Grounds Committee is looking into several issues regarding the burn site.

These include illegal dumping and resulting penalties, penalties if the rules for brush pickup are not followed and security cameras and signs at the dump.
